What Are Tobacco Replacement Products?
Tobacco replacement products encompass a variety of alternatives designed to help individuals reduce or eliminate their reliance on traditional tobacco products. These can include nicotine replacement therapies (NRTs) such as gums, patches, lozenges, inhalers, and nasal sprays that deliver controlled doses of nicotine to alleviate withdrawal symptoms. Additionally, there are herbal and natural substitutes that mimic the experience of smoking without the harmful chemicals found in tobacco. Ultimately, these products are intended to ease the transition away from tobacco while still addressing physical and psychological cravings.

Common Myths About Tobacco Replacement
Despite the proven effectiveness of tobacco replacement strategies, several myths still persist. One common misconception is that using nicotine replacement products simply prolongs nicotine addiction. In reality, these products are specifically designed to help taper down nicotine consumption safely. Another prevalent myth is that herbal or alternative replacements are completely risk-free; however, it’s essential to research and understand each product, as even natural substances can have side effects or interactions. Lastly, some believe that cessation methods, such as vaporizing or using e-cigarettes, are entirely safe, though ongoing studies reveal potential health risks associated with them.

Assessing Your Withdrawal Symptoms
When embarking on a plan to replace tobacco, it’s crucial to assess any withdrawal symptoms you may encounter. Common symptoms include irritability, anxiety, increased appetite, and cravings for nicotine. Keeping a withdrawal journal can help track the severity and duration of these symptoms, informing your approach to treatment. Different replacement options may cater effectively to specific symptoms; for instance, if anxiety is a primary concern, selecting a method with calming properties may be advantageous. Herbal and Natural Alternatives to Tobacco
Popular Herbal Remedies for Tobacco Replacement
There exists a broad range of herbal and natural alternatives that people are turning to as substitutes for tobacco. Some of the popular options include:
- Passionflower: Known for its calming effects, this herb can reduce anxiety and soothe withdrawal symptoms.
- Damiana: This natural herb can help mimic the smoking experience, providing a satisfying feeling without the nicotine.
- Lavender: Recognized for its relaxation properties, lavender can help alleviate stress and anxiety associated with quitting tobacco.
- Green Tea: A healthy beverage alternative, green tea provides antioxidants and promotes overall well-being during the cessation process.
These options can be used in various forms including teas, capsules, or dried herbs for smoking, making them versatile additions to a tobacco replacement strategy.

Comparative Analysis of Natural Versus Synthetic Options
When weighing options for tobacco replacement, a comparative analysis between natural and synthetic alternatives is invaluable. Natural remedies, like herbal products, often pose fewer side effects and provide a holistic approach to cessation. However, their effectiveness varies from person to person, and some may require gradual adjustment to achieve results. Conversely, synthetic options, such as NRTs, have been clinically tested for efficacy and can offer quicker relief from withdrawal symptoms but may result in side effects, such as skin irritation from patches. Finding the right balance by possibly combining both strategies can optimize your tobacco replacement efforts.
